In cooking, such as for dressings and sauces you can add ¾ greek yogurt directly to the dish without diluting it ( ¾ cup greek yogurt = 1 cup regular yogurt ). Smooth and lightly sweet, applesauce adds moisture making it an excellent greek yogurt substitute in many sweeter recipes. Store bought dairy free yogurt products. Simply pickup a container of dairy free yogurt from your local supermarket! if using greek yogurt in baking (muffins, cakes, bread, etc.) mix ¾ cup greek yogurt with ¼ cup water to replace 1 cup of regular yogurt. First and foremost, the easiest option. Applesauce has a distinctly different flavor and sweetness compared with yogurt so it is not a good option for savory dishes.
